NEARLY 40,000 OREGON HOUSEHOLDS RECEIVE RENTAL ASSISTANCE

February 18, 2022 3:00 a.m.

Nearly 40,000 Oregon households facing pandemic hardship have received over $282 million in rental assistance relief through the Oregon Emergency Rental Assistance Program, as of February 14th.

A release from the Oregon Housing and Community Services said OERAP continues to be one of the nation’s top-performing programs and is ranked 4th in the nation, in the percentage of federal ERA funds paid out and obligated, as tracked by the National Low- Income Housing Coalition.

OHCS is currently accepting new applications following its portal reopening on January 26th. Tenants can apply at www.oregonrentalassistance.org or call 211 with questions. New applications will start getting reviewed for payment once the portal closes to new clients.
